Saurabh Sharma is the Chief Product Officer at You.com, a privacy-focused AI search and productivity platform that delivers over 1 billion answers monthly across the open web and enterprise systems. He joined You.com in August 2023 as Vice President of Product Management and was promoted to CPO in May 2024, leading product strategy for enterprise AI tools and intelligent AI agents. Prior to You.com, Sharma spent more than a decade at Google as a Group Product Manager overseeing Google Assistant, Gmail, and AI/ML initiatives, and served as Head of Search Products at OpenSea during a critical phase in the NFT market.

Career Journey Before You.com
Sharma's professional trajectory reveals decades of expertise built through progressive leadership roles at industry-defining companies. His career began at IBM in engineering leadership positions before he co-founded a medical software startup, demonstrating early entrepreneurial spirit.
- IBM Engineering Roles - Early career engineering leadership in enterprise software systems
- Medical Software Startup Co-Founder - Entrepreneurial venture in healthcare technology
- Google Group Product Manager - Over 10 years leading Google Assistant, Gmail, Google+, and kids/family products with AI/ML integration
- Head of Search Products at OpenSea - Oversaw search, discovery, and trust & safety during pivotal NFT market phase
- Vice President of Product Management at You.com - August 2023 to May 2024
- Chief Product Officer at You.com - May 2024 to present

Product Philosophy and Frameworks
Sharma advocates for strategic thinking over feature-building as software commoditizes, emphasizing that product managers must delegate delegate IC work to AI agents rather than micromanaging every detail. His "Three E's framework"-Exploration, Expansion, Engineering-guides strategy navigation in ambiguous frontier markets where product-market fit remains unclear.
In AI product development, Sharma argues that evals are the new PRD, replacing traditional product requirement documents with rigorous evaluation frameworks. He emphasizes building AI products users actually trust and adopt, with ethics, compliance, and tone central to responsible AI design.
